Toyota Prius+ Price and Insurance Cost




The Toyota Prius + is a hybrid minivan mechanically similar to the Toyota Prius, ie it is a hybrid car that moves with an electric motor and a petrol. The battery that powers the electric motor can not be charged to an outlet (which is possible in the Prius Plug-in Hybrid)

It is available from 28 000 euros and three trim levels (all prices and equipment). Its starting price seems high, but it is hard to compare because none of their competitors are hybrids. Most of the diesel MPVs its size and power are clearly less expensive, as the Opel Zafira Tourer, Renault Grand Scenic and the Ford Grand C-MAX. For the price of the Toyota Prius + MPV can access larger, such as the Ford S-Max 2.0 TDCi 140 hp. It is also more expensive and larger than a Toyota Verso.

The Prius + at the lowest possible equipment is 4700 euros more expensive than the Prius and its body is 13.5 inches long. The clearest advantage of a Prius compared to a Prius is that it has seven seats. You can also make sense to pay the difference if only five seats are used, as their occupants will travel better than in a normal Prius as there is more space in all directions every square is individual.


The seven-seat Prius + are arranged in three rows of seats ( its configuration is 2/3 /2). The first five are very large , while in the last two fit enough to comfort two people of approximately 1.80 m tall. Access is not very comfortable, but once inside , you travel better than them for a Ford Grand C -MAX or a Chevrolet Orlando.
Although room for occupants is above average, per trunk is the worst . With the first two rows of seats in the service position , the boot is not big nor is usable forms . This consideration is made by measuring their ability to the curtain that covers : much volume can be increased by loading up the roof , but it is not a safe option because networks can not be installed vertical or something similar that separates the cargo space for occupant .
For its silhouette, the Toyota Prius + is difficult to place on the market. Its body is less high than many competitors and their seats are closer to the ground . Somehow, it is halfway between a Toyota Avensis Wagon and a Toyota Verso.
It can be a very satisfying vehicle depending on the use made of it . Possibly the best MPV in its price for city or roads around where you can circulate sustained speed . Especially in town , has a particularly low fuel consumption and outstanding running smoothness (partly because sometimes moves only using the electric motor) . It also helps your driving ease not having to drive a stick shift .
However, it does not seem as good to use mainly on roads where necessary usually much acceleration or climbing steep slopes because the power can be low and the noise inside , high. For the money this Prius + MPV are going better in rough roads .


In the city and surrounding spends less than its competitors but in typical highway trip does not offer consumer a clear advantage (least cost per kilometer) compared to diesel-engine minibuses. The minimum consumption may be about 5.0 l/100 km and not normal to spend more than 7.5 l/100 km.

According to our measurements, Prius consumption is slightly larger than a normal Prius since heavier and is more aerodynamic drag.

Like the Prius, the Prius + is planned to install a tow hook (picture of what the manual says about it).

Equipment and other details

There are three trim levels: 'Eco', 'Advance' and 'Executive'. I find it difficult to choose one or the other, as each one has a set of elements that can not be purchased separately and not all customer will be of interest. For example, the headlights of LEDs for lighting function short range one can have with the Prius + more expensive, but that necessitates carrying leather upholstery (apparently is of good quality to the touch, but I did not choose it scarcely back breathes and just soaked easily, at least in warm weather). A curious element linked to the Prius + equipment more expensive are the "water repellent moons" of the front doors. After having driven in heavy rain, I have the feeling that the drops on the glass sliding rapidly, leaving almost no trace and, when dry, the glass was cleaner than usual.
 


The intermediate level of equipment, 'Advance', perhaps the most interesting because it seems to already have a number of things that come in handy in a car such as rear camera parking aid and curtains on the side windows of the rear doors. Necessarily comes with halogen bulbs headlights, that of which I can not give an opinion because I have not tried.

One of the attractions of the version less equipment, "Echo", is that due to the smaller size of its wheels, you need considerably less room to maneuver than the other two. For the same reason, Toyota approves lower fuel consumption for the Prius + with this level of equipment.

other data

The Prius + version for USA Prius v is called. The main difference between the European and the American model is that the former has seven seats as standard and the second only five.
